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our team will conduct a thorough assessment of the damage to your belongings. We’ll identify the extent of the damage, find out the most effective restoration methods, and develop a customized plan to meet your unique needs.
Step 2: Equipment Setup and Drying
We’ll use advanced equipment, including industrial-grade dehumidifiers and high-velocity fans, to dry and restore your contents quickly and efficiently. Our team will closely monitor the drying process to ensure that your belongings are restored to their former condition.
Step 3: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Once the contents are dry, our team will thoroughly clean and sanitize them to remove any remaining moisture, dirt, or debris. This ensures that your belongings are safe to use and reduces the risk of further damage or mold growth.
Step 4: Final Inspection and Completion
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that your belongings meet our high standards of quality and safety. We’ll make any necessary adjustments and complete the restoration process, leaving you with restored contents that look and feel like new.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Musty odors can be a sign of hidden mold growth or water damage. If you notice persistent musty smells, it’s essential to investigate and address the issue quickly to prevent further damage and health risks. Our team can help you identify the source of the odor and develop a plan to remove it.
Warped or Discolored Belongings
Warped or discolored belongings can show water damage or exposure to extreme temperatures. If you notice any signs of warping or discoloration, it’s crucial to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age and restore your belongings to their former condition.

Q: What is Contents Restoration Services?
Contents Restoration Services is a specialized service that involves the assessment, cleaning, drying, and restoration of damaged or contaminated contents, including furniture, carpets, curtains, and other household items.
